Security (Financial)
What are the two main types of securities?
The two main types of securities are equity securities and debt securities.
How do equity securities generate income for investors?
Equity securities can generate income through dividends paid to shareholders.
What is the primary difference between primary and secondary markets?
The primary market is where securities are created and sold for the first time, while the secondary market is where previously issued securities are traded among investors.
Why are securities heavily regulated?
Securities are heavily regulated to ensure transparency, fairness, and investor protection in the financial markets.
What role do securities play in wealth management?
Securities provide avenues for growth, income, and capital preservation, helping wealth managers construct tailored portfolios for clients.
